Indiana Wesleyan University-Marion vs California State University-Stanislaus
Marion, IN — Turlock, CA
| Metric | Indiana Wesleyan University-Marion Marion, IN | California State University-Stanislaus Turlock, CA |
|---|---|---|
| Location | Marion, IN | Turlock, CA |
| Type | Private Nonprofit | Public |
| Total Enrollment | 1,974 | 8,385 |
| Acceptance Rate | 88.9% | 98.1% |
| SAT Average | 1,082 | — |
| In-State Tuition | $32,352 | $8,246 |
| Out-of-State Tuition | $32,352 | $20,846 |
| Avg Net Price | $22,866 | $6,067 |
| Median Debt at Graduation | $24,250 | $13,540 |
| 4-Year Graduation Rate | 66.5% | 55.6% |
| Retention Rate | 82.9% | 82.5% |
| Median Earnings (6 yr) | $51,329 | $47,793 |
| Median Earnings (10 yr) | $59,986 | $63,188 |

Frequently Asked Questions
How do Indiana Wesleyan University-Marion and California State University-Stanislaus compare?▼
Indiana Wesleyan University-Marion (Marion, IN) has an acceptance rate of 88.9%, in-state tuition of $32,352, and median 10-year earnings of $59,986. California State University-Stanislaus (Turlock, CA) has an acceptance rate of 98.1%, in-state tuition of $8,246, and median 10-year earnings of $63,188.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, Indiana Wesleyan University-Marion or California State University-Stanislaus?▼
California State University-Stanislaus gra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$63,188 vs $59,986.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, Indiana Wesleyan University-Marion or California State University-Stanislaus?▼
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), California State University-Stanislaus is the more affordable option at $6,067 per year versus $22,866.
Which school has a better 4-year graduation rate?▼
Indiana Wesleyan University-Marion has the higher 4-year graduation rate: 66.5% vs 55.6%.
